Open to greater fruitfulness

Our ears hear sounds, but the brain deciphers meaning. Our openness to the Holy Spirit and to growth in faith and life influences what we allow ourselves to understand. Belief cannot be forced. Each person is invited to fruitfulness, yet the way we respond is a complex interrelationship between lived experiences, needs and desires, woundedness and the grace of God. Note that even on good soil, yields can differ greatly. Today we pray for compassion for ourselves and those who struggle with faith. Ask for the grace to be open to the call of God and to greater fruitfulness.
